#3b6ca2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b6ca2 is composed of 23.1% red, 42.4%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.6% cyan, 33.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 211.5 degrees, a saturation of 46.6% and a lightness of 43.3%. #3b6ca2 color hex could be obtained by blending #76d8ff with #000045.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#3b6ca2 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#3b6ca2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3b6ca2 has RGB values of R:59, G:108, B:162 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 3894434.

Shades and Tints of #3b6ca2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010304 is the darkest color, while #f4f8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b6ca2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6e6f is the less saturated color, while #086ad5 is the most saturated one.
